如何实现针对IIS的防盗链和防止迅雷下载?

IIS防盗链, 防迅雷唯一方案(safe3if)

如何实现针对IIS的防盗链和防止迅雷下载?

简介

IIS (Internet Information Services) 是微软开发的网页服务器,在网络资源分享中,经常会出现未经授权的盗链现象,即其他网站直接链接到你的服务器上的文件,造成不必要的流量损失和潜在的安全风险,针对这一问题,开发者可以采用多种策略来防止盗链,其中safe3if是一种有效的解决方案。

safe3if方案

safe3if是一种基于IIS的模块,它能够有效识别并阻止非法的资源请求,此模块通过分析请求头部信息,判断请求是否合法,从而决定是否提供资源。

安装与配置

1、下载与安装

访问safe3if官方网站或可信的第三方网站下载safe3if模块。

将下载的文件解压到适当的目录。

在IIS管理器中,通过模块功能添加safe3if模块。

如何实现针对IIS的防盗链和防止迅雷下载?

2、配置规则

编辑safe3if配置文件(通常为web.config),设置允许或拒绝的规则。

定义合法的引用站点列表,只有这些站点才能访问资源。

设定用户代理过滤规则,例如禁止包含“迅雷”等关键字的请求。

3、测试与调整

在配置后,进行充分的测试以确保规则生效且不影响正常用户体验。

根据实际运行情况调整规则,优化性能和安全性。

使用效果

减少盗链:显著降低非法资源请求,节约带宽资源。

如何实现针对IIS的防盗链和防止迅雷下载?

提升安全性:通过用户代理过滤,降低了服务器遭受自动化攻击工具的风险。

易于管理:通过配置文件可以轻松更改规则,适应不同的保护需求。

相关问题与解答

Q1: 使用safe3if会影响搜索引擎的正常抓取吗?

A1: 如果配置得当,safe3if不会影响搜索引擎的正常抓取,可以通过设置搜索引擎爬虫的用户代理白名单,确保它们能够正常访问网站内容。

Q2: safe3if能否完全阻止所有的非法下载行为?

A2: 虽然safe3if可以大幅度降低非法下载行为,但没有任何系统能够保证100%的安全,还需要结合其他安全措施,如定期更新和监控日志,以进一步保障网站安全。

通过上述的详细介绍,可以看出safe3if是一个有效的IIS防盗链和防迅雷下载的解决方案,正确配置并结合其他安全措施,可以显著提高网站的安全性和资源的合理利用。